NOTE: Updated player skill attribute scores are in comparison to his peer group at the AHL level.
Has spent the majority of the year at the AHL level playing with the Condors and he's much improved overall.
Much more confident executing with the puck. Distributing very well on the PP. Calm and composed under pressure. Uses his skating and agility to escape pressure and make plays. Directs plays on net or finds open team mates through seams.
As mentioned, skating remains an element that works in his favor. Good size, but not physical.
His willingness to 'box out' around his crease and engage physically to keep pucks out of danger areas around his net remains average.
2-way / Transitional 'D' at the AHL level - PP QB - being used in all situations - average plus defensively.
